What are some other ways Americans could have helped their country
during World War II? How about now?

Answer:

They could pay war bonds, which lended money to the US ogvernment to be used for war efforts. Once a person bought a war bond, they were garunteed to be paid back with an interest. Today, we do not have a war to assist in, but there new ways American citizens can help out with their government. For example, they can participate in American Red Cross, where people can donate blood or volunteer to work for American Red Cross.
